EPL: Why I left Chelsea for RB Leipzig – Timo Werner

New Red Bull Leipzig signing, Timo Werner, has suggested that he left Chelsea to join the German club because he wants to reach the 100-goal mark at the club.

Werner also insisted that he had a ‘good time in England’, despite struggling to impress at Chelsea following his £53m move to Stamford Bridge back in 2020.

The German international completed his £25.3 million return to Leipzig on Wednesday, having previously left Germany as the club’s all-time top scorer.

Werner scored 90 times in 157 appearances at Leipzig before his departure to Chelsea but quickly saw his goal tally plummet in England, registering just 23 goals in 89 games during his two-year spell with Chelsea.

“I am very happy to be able to play for RB Leipzig again. I had a great time here between 2016 and 2020 when we performed brilliantly as newcomers in the league,” Werner was quoted by RB Leipzig’s official website as saying.

“I had two great years at Chelsea that I am really grateful we were crowned with the Champions League trophy. The experience to play abroad in a new league really helped me and my career. Now I am looking forward to the new season with RB Leipzig and above all to meeting the Leipzig fans again, who mean a great deal to me. We want to achieve a lot and of course, I want to become the first Leipzig player to reach the 100-goal mark.”

UEL: Wonderful, fantastic player – Joe Cole hails Arsenal star after latest win

Former England midfielder Joe Cole has spoken glowingly of Arsenal’s Bukayo Saka after the 21-year-old helped the Gunners secure their 11th win from 12 games this season.

Saka’s goal in the Europa League on Thursday helped Arsenal beat Bodo-Glimt and Cole sees the England star as a ‘wonderful player.’

Cole, a former England midfielder, noted that Saka has a wonderful combination of speed and ball control.

Cole said on BT Sport, “He’s a wonderful player and every time I SEE him he’s improving.”

He noted that at a very young age, the England winger is already a leader on the pitch, describing the 21-year-old as a gem.

“He’s a fantastic footballer and one Arsenal need to tie down and build a team around.”

Arsenal have not dropped a point in the Europa League this season, winning their first three matches.

CAF Champions League: Rivers United arrive Morocco for Wydad clash

Nigeria Professional Football League champions, Rivers United have arrived Morocco ahead of their CAF Champions League first round second leg clash against Wydad Athletic Club.

A 35-man contingent consisting of players and officials of the club arrived the Mohamed V International Airport late Thursday night after a brief stopover in Cotonou, Benin Republic.

Rivers United head into the game with a 2-1 advantage from the first leg.

Sunday’s encounter will hold at the 67,000 capacity Mohammed V Stadium, Casablanca.

The game will kick-off at at 7pm Nigeria time.

Nigeria’s other representative in the competition, Plateau United will be up against Esperance of Tunisia on Saturday.

UEL: He’s just different class – Martin Keown singles out Arsenal star after latest win

Martin Keown has hailed Bukayo Saka, saying the England star has gone to another level in football.

Arsenal beat Bodo/Glimt in the Europa League on Thursday as they continue their fine run of form this season and Keown believes Saka has been actively involved.

The England international scored his fourth goal of the season to put the Gunners ahead against Bodo/Glimt in Norway.

“When you get the ball to players like Bukayo Saka… he’s just different class at the moment this fella. He’s got the full-back on toast tonight,” Keown told BT Sport

“It was a great run for the goal, obviously he gets lucky, but it’s brilliant how he gets into that area. He’s gone to another level.”
